The size of Mondrook is approximately 13.2 square kilometres. The population of Mondrook in 2016 was 175 people. By 2021 the population was 167 showing a population decline of 4.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mondrook is 60-69 years. Households in Mondrook are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mondrook work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 81.90% of the homes in Mondrook were owner-occupied compared with 87.30% in 2016.
